Games
Anti-cheat software
If you have an issue suspending a game, check if it uses
Easy Anti-Cheat
or similar software by searching for it at PCGamingWiki
and checking if the "Middleware" section lists Easy Anti-Cheat
.
Nyrna is unlikely to work with games that use anti-cheat software, as these frameworks are designed specifically to block other software from interacting with the game.
Sometimes the anti-cheat software can be disabled, such as in Elden Ring.

Shortcuts don't work
Use the GUI method to toggle suspend/resume.
Some games grab exclusive control of the mouse and keyboard, which can cause Nyrna's shortcuts to not work. This is an unfortunate limitation of the game, and not something that can be fixed in Nyrna.
It might be worthwhile to contact the game's developers and let them know that their game grabbing exclusive control of the mouse and keyboard is causing issues.
